Sony VAIO NRSony prepares the launch of the VAIO NR series laptops, according to specifications leaked from a German website.

NotebookReview reports the VAIO NR is a pretty basic 15.4″ widescreen laptop, featuring Intel Core 2 Duo processor and integrated graphics. This Intel “Santa Rosa” platform-based notebook has the GMA X3100 video solution and 802.11 a/b/g wireless connectivity. The two listed models, aimed at European market, will come with 2GB of system memory and a 200GB hard drive.

These laptops provide four USB ports, ExpressCard, Memory Stick, and SD card slots, a FireWire port, and a VGA output.

The Sony Vaio NR is expected to become available this fall, with a price starting at around $899 reportedly. Currently, there is no information on its availability in the United States.
